当前位置: 首页 > news >正文

二级分销爆单的“财务噩梦”:为什么微商城一卡,老板的钱就被多提现了?

在私域流量变现与本地生活数字化流转中,“二级分销”与“多级裂变”是企业获客的核心驱动力。很多老板重金买了一套源码,平时跑跑小单一切正常,可一旦遇到头部大 V 带货爆单,系统瞬间就会遭遇底层数据灾难:要么页面卡死报错,要么更可怕——出现“跳档错误”和“佣金重叠提现”,直接给公司造成不可逆的巨额财务损失。

今天,我们从底层代码层面,扒一扒那些劣质外包系统在面临高并发分销时,到底埋了多大的雷。

一、 分销系统的两大底层“技术暗雷”

1. 行级锁死锁风暴(并发更新的灾难)

想象一个场景:一个拥有数万粉丝的大 V 瞬间爆单,成百上千名下级消费者的订单在同一秒内涌入系统。 底层系统需要同时执行两个动作:更新大 V 的累计业绩、根据最新业绩计算他是否触发“升级”(比如从 V1 级的 10% 提成,升级为 V2 级的 15%)。 传统劣质系统在处理这些并发请求时,会瞬间把数据库里大 V 的这一行数据死死锁住。当多个并发线程相互等待对方释放资源时,底层立刻演变为“数据库死锁”。前端表现就是:用户下单付不了款、支付回调超时,后台直接崩溃。

2. 异步状态机失效引发的“提成重复发放”

为了解决卡顿,有些开发会自作聪明采用“先扣款、再异步计算分销升级”的设计。 这就导致在爆单临界点(比如大 V 恰好差 1 单就升级的瞬间),多笔订单同时触发结算。系统由于读到了“旧的业绩缓存”发生误判,导致大 V 在同一个档位上被重复发放了多次高额提成。钱账对不上,财务彻底崩溃。

二、 斩断分销死锁风暴的架构解法

针对此类高并发账目卡点,单纯靠给服务器加 CPU 核心数是毫无意义的,必须通过底层架构重构实现“账目绝对隔离与无锁化”。

1. 引入 Redis + Lua 脚本的前置无锁化结算

在底层架构设计上,严禁高并发流量直接冲击核心资产表。我们引入 Redis 集群作为前置结算缓冲区,利用 Lua 脚本的绝对原子性,将【扣减库存 + 累加分销业绩 + 判定跳档】这三个动作打包成单次内存操作。 流量在内存层已经被处理为无冲突的线性序列。异常请求直接在缓存层予以拦截,将主库的事务并发压力直接降低 95% 以上。

2. 分布式红锁(Redlock)的双保险边界

对于进入后端的结算请求,通过分布式红锁(Redlock)死死锁住【分销商 ID + 账期节点】。即使现场网络极其恶劣导致回调信号重发,系统底层的幂等性网关也能确保同一笔资金绝不发生二次误扣与重复发放。

三、 避坑指南

多级分销系统的核心研发门槛,从来不是前端页面有多好看,而是在于系统面对海量并发时,能否死死守住企业的“资金安全死线”。懂业务流程和状态机硬逻辑,才是企业数字化的真正护城河。

注:(文献白皮书编号:XG-DIST-2026-06)。

http://www.gsyq.cn/news/1625131.html

相关文章:

  • 马尔可夫链与HMM工程实战:从状态设计到生产部署
  • 搭建微信电商小程序要多少钱:定制和SaaS商城怎么选更适合实体店
  • 二十年只为超越,ROG玩家国度与蜘蛛侠共赴英雄新章
  • 智慧校园运维升级实战:IoT智能锁通断电联动+身份核验解决方案落地
  • 自动驾驶量产落地的11个关键节点与三大非热点机会
  • 5步快速掌握Godot逆向工程工具:资源提取与脚本反编译终极指南
  • 机器学习生产化落地:四层健康探针实战指南
  • 固定式与手持式RFID阅读器选型:工业RFID系统架构与部署分析
  • Kiran-Flameshot故障排除:常见问题解决方案大全
  • 2026最新云渲染农场排行榜:高效渲染平台怎么选?这份榜单值得收藏
  • 海洋石油平台防爆摄像机工况适配、防爆规范与环境防护技术方案
  • AI商业闭环打通资本开支持续,光互联迎黄金时代,投资可沿四条主线展开
  • Qwen3.5大模型微调入门实战(完整代码)
  • 国产开源图片大模型选型指南:中文对齐、低显存推理与商用落地
  • 红外积分球探测气体验证设备选型:300℃溶剂气化温度配制标气技术解析
  • AI工作站选型避坑指南:系统级性能瓶颈深度解析
  • 企业级AI接口统一调度平台排行:五家主流选手实测对比
  • 投资3000亿绑定OpenAI,甲骨文算力布局背后,客户违约风险引发华尔街焦虑!
  • AI 代码贡献激增,Godot 基金会修订贡献者政策严控 AI 使用
  • 新会上线!第三届大数据分析与人工智能应用国际学术会议(BDAIA 2026)
  • 告别龟速下载:用Python解析工具解锁百度网盘10倍下载速度
  • IPD咨询洞察:矩阵组织总变成“扯皮阵“,华为如何经历这个过程?
  • 程序员凌晨4点重写代码引热议:重写到底为了谁?
  • [特殊字符] C 语言避坑指南:为什么我的 strlen 算出的是 40 而不是 10?
  • 《列表和元组到底是有什么异同呢?》
  • SAP-ABAP:SAP QM 检验结果录入核心利器:BAPI_INSPOPER_RECORDRESULTS 完全指南
  • 如何利用软件计算流域面积(Global Mapeer)
  • 为什么说“无需逐字雕琢”也能搞定朱雀 AI 判定?
  • Gemini 3.1 Pro与GPT-5.4工程选型指南:认知中枢vs执行引擎
  • 从沈管家看AI数字员工的技术演进:告别“聊天”,走向“执行”